What We’re Learning This Week:

Math-We will be wrapping up our unit on Place Value and expanded form. There will be an assessment on Friday.

Reading-This week we will be learning that good readers ask questions when they read.  We will practice asking our Who? What? When? and Why? questions before, during and after reading. We will also review the story elements when reading.

Writing-We will continue adding details to our stories to help bring our characters to life for our readers by describing what they say and what they do. Please send in your child’s pictures if you haven’t already! Thank you!

Phonics-We will be learning about the words in the -ICK  (i.e. brick) and -IP (i.e. slip) families. Our first Spelling Test will be this Friday! Words to study will be in the red homework folders.

Science- Last week we went to the ILC and did research on Magnets. Our class did an awesome job taking notes from Pebble Go. This week we will be wrapping up our unit on Magnets and will continue to focus upon the vocabulary words: attract, repel, force, and poles. We will have an assessment this Friday.

S.T.E.A.M. We will be doing a S.T.E.A.M.  activity involving magnets.
